![240](https://cdn2.jianshu.io/assets/default_avatar/9-cceda3cf5072bcdd77e8ca4f21c40998.jpg?imageMogr2/auto-orient/strip|imageView2/1/w/240/h/240)
1 秒殺業(yè)務(wù)分析# 正常電子商務(wù)流程 (1)查詢商品宅静;(2)創(chuàng)建訂單章蚣;(3)扣減庫(kù)存;(4)更新訂單姨夹;(5)付款;(6)賣家發(fā)貨矾策; 秒殺業(yè)務(wù)的特性 (1)低廉價(jià)格磷账;(2)大幅...
JDK提供了大量?jī)?yōu)秀的集合實(shí)現(xiàn)供開(kāi)發(fā)者使用逃糟,合格的程序員必須要能夠通過(guò)功能場(chǎng)景和性能需求選用最合適的集合,這就要求開(kāi)發(fā)者必須熟悉Java的常用集合類。本文將就Java Col...
這都不知道就不要去大公司面試了绰咽,丟人 java并發(fā)面試題(一)基礎(chǔ)本文整理了常見(jiàn)的Java并發(fā)面試題菇肃,希望對(duì)大家面試有所幫助,歡迎大家互相交流取募。多線程java中有幾種方法可以...
來(lái)源:陶邦仁 鏈接:http://my.oschina.net/xianggao/blog/524943 0 系列目錄 秒殺系統(tǒng)架構(gòu) 秒殺系統(tǒng)架構(gòu)分析與實(shí)戰(zhàn) 1 秒殺業(yè)務(wù)分析...
一琐谤、什么是高并發(fā) 高并發(fā)是指在同一個(gè)時(shí)間點(diǎn),有大量用戶同時(shí)訪問(wèn)URL地址玩敏,比如淘寶雙11斗忌、定時(shí)領(lǐng)取紅包就會(huì)產(chǎn)生高并發(fā);又比如貼吧的爆吧旺聚,就是惡意的高并發(fā)請(qǐng)求织阳,也就是DDOS攻...
簡(jiǎn)書 占小狼轉(zhuǎn)載請(qǐng)注明原創(chuàng)出處,謝謝砰粹! 前言 ThreadLocal為變量在每個(gè)線程中都創(chuàng)建了一個(gè)副本唧躲,所以每個(gè)線程可以訪問(wèn)自己內(nèi)部的副本變量,不同線程之間不會(huì)互相干擾碱璃。本文...
ThreadLocal是面試中比較容易碰上的問(wèn)題弄痹,一般會(huì)要求講解它的實(shí)現(xiàn)原理以及存在的問(wèn)題。最近在美團(tuán)的面試中聊到這個(gè)問(wèn)題厘贼,雖然去年有看過(guò)并收藏了關(guān)于ThreadLocal的...
一. 網(wǎng)絡(luò)編程基礎(chǔ) 在移動(dòng)互聯(lián)網(wǎng)時(shí)代界酒,幾乎所有應(yīng)用都需要用到網(wǎng)絡(luò),只有通過(guò)網(wǎng)絡(luò)跟外界進(jìn)行數(shù)據(jù)交互嘴秸、數(shù)據(jù)更新毁欣,應(yīng)用才能保持新鮮、活力岳掐。一個(gè)好的移動(dòng)網(wǎng)絡(luò)應(yīng)用不僅要有良好的UI和良...
本文轉(zhuǎn)載自http://blog.jobbole.com/24006/ 摘要本文以MySQL數(shù)據(jù)庫(kù)為研究對(duì)象凭疮,討論與數(shù)據(jù)庫(kù)索引相關(guān)的一些話題。特別需要說(shuō)明的是串述,MySQL支持...
Spark專用名詞 RDD ---- resillient distributed dataset 彈性分布式數(shù)據(jù)集 Operation ---- 作用于RDD的各種操作分為...
本文內(nèi)容基于Spark最新版1.6.1 Spark 最初只有Spark Core纲酗,通過(guò)逐步的發(fā)展衰腌,現(xiàn)在已擴(kuò)展出Spark SQL、Spark Streaming觅赊、Spark ...
Spark學(xué)習(xí)筆記 Data Source->Kafka->Spark Streaming->Parquet->Spark SQL(SparkSQL可以結(jié)合ML萝风、GraphX...
volatile關(guān)鍵字經(jīng)常在并發(fā)編程中使用,其特性是保證可見(jiàn)性以及有序性规惰,但是關(guān)于volatile的使用仍然要小心睬塌,這需要明白volatile關(guān)鍵字的特性及實(shí)現(xiàn)的原理,這也是...